Preston's Summary

Janvi Manchanda is a journalist at Hauterrfly. She uses her writing to challenge societal norms, exploring themes in beauty and fashion, consumer travel, and public policy. Her work delves into the intricacies of the beauty industry, makeup, skincare, and the intersection of government and politics.
